In this episode, Shamus Madan converses with Josh Felser about his entrepreneurial journey, the importance of pioneering in new technologies, and the role of AI in climate tech. They delve into Felser's leadership style, transition from entrepreneurship to venture capitalism, and the significance of investing in Climate Tech. The episode also touches on circularity in industries, integrating sustainability, and the story behind Travis Kalanick's choice between Formspring and Uber. The episode concludes with an introduction to Climatic VC.

Today we have to talk about climate change. There’s more carbon dioxide in our air than at any time in human history. And it could end up being irreversible if corrective action isn’t taken. Today, Josh Felser joins the podcast to discuss his new firm, Climactic, investing in enterprise and mobility climate solutions. Prior to Climactic, Josh was the founder of Spinner, which he co-founded with his business partner Dave Samuel. It was one of the first online music and entertainment services that he sold to AOL for $320 Million. He also co-founded Crackle with Dave and sold that company to Sony for $65 Million. After being in the entrepreneurial world for a while he decided to launch his own fund Freestyle, investing in companies like Airtable and Patreon. He recently left to launch Climactic.
